Why does the US import oil?

A.because it has exported too much oil
B.because it does not produce any oil
C.because it does not produce enough oil
D.because it has exported too little oil


Answers

Answer:

C. because it does not produce enough oil.

Explanation:

Although, the United States is one of the leading producers of oil, yet still import oil because it does not produce enough oil to meet the demand of its citizens. In other words, the United States consumes more than what she can produce.

Another reason is that most refineries in the United State are created basically for heavy crude whereas most of what she produce are light crude oil. The United States import the oil she is able to process while she export to other countries to complete the setup process.

The remedy to the above situation is when new refineries are built which are somewhat expensive or the existing refineries are upgraded to meet with the demand.

Jim has an annual salary of $96,000. His monthly expenses include a $2,500 mortgage payment, a $250 lease payment, $500 in minimum credit card payments, and a $425 payment on his speed boat. He also receives $1,200 in interest from his savings and other accounts each month. Calculate Jim’s DTI (debt-to-income) ratio. A. 30% b. 35% c. 40% d. 45% Please select the best answer from the choices provided A B C D.

Answers

The debt to income ratio of Jim for the particular year is 40%.

How to compute the debt-to-income ratio?

Given,

Annual salary =$96,000

Interest received on saving account (monthly) =$1,200.

The interest received for the entire year will be:

\(\begin{aligned}\rm{Total\; Interest \;Income}&=\rm{Monthly\;Income}\times12\\&=\$1,200\times12\\&=\$14,400\end{aligned}\)

Monthly expenses:

mortgage payment =$2,500; lease payment =$250; minimum credit card payment =$500; and speed boat =$425.

The yearly expenses will be:

\(\begin{aligned}\text{Total Expenses}&=\text{Sum of all Monthly Expenses}\times12\\&=(\$2,500+\$250+\$500+\$425)\times12\\&=\$3,675\times12\\&=\$44,100\end{aligned}\)

Now, the debt to income ratio is computed as follows:

\(\begin{aligned}\text{Debt to Income Ratio}&=\dfrac{\text{Total Expenses}}{\text{Total Interest Income + Annual Salary}}\\&=\dfrac{\$44,100}{\$14,400+\$96,000}\\&=0.399\;\text{or}\; 40\%\end{aligned}\)

Therefore, option c. 40% is correct.

Three months ago you purchased fsl stock for $25 per share. today you sold the stock for $31 per share. what is your annualized return on this investment expressed as an apr?

Answers

The annualized return on this investment, expressed as an APR, is 96%.

To calculate the annualized return on investment, we need to know the time period for which the investment was held. If we assume that three months is the holding period, we can calculate the annualized return as follows:

First, calculate the total return by subtracting the purchase price from the selling price: $31 - $25 = $6.

Next, calculate the return percentage by dividing the total return by the purchase price: $6 / $25 = 0.24.

To annualize the return, we need to adjust for the three-month holding period. Since there are four three-month periods in a year, multiply the return percentage by four: 0.24 * 4 = 0.96.

Finally, convert the annualized return to an Annual Percentage Rate (APR) by multiplying by 100: 0.96 * 100 = 96%.

Therefore, the annualized return on this investment, expressed as an APR, is 96%.

What is a system in which the government plans and determines the production of goods and services?.

Answers

A command economy is an economic system in which the government plans and determines the production of goods and services.

What is a command economy ?A command economy is a crucial component of a political system in which the degree of output that is permitted and the prices that may be paid for products and services are set by a central governing body. Most industries are owned by the public.The principal alternative to a command economy is a free market economy where supply and demand determine prices and output.A communist political system includes a command economy, whereas capitalist countries have a free market.In a command economy, the central authority establishes the amount of output, manages the flow of products, and sets the pricing.Government control, as opposed to private enterprise, according to proponents of command economies, can guarantee a just distribution of commodities and services.
